A robust and reliable medical gas pipeline system is paramount to ensuring patient safety and effective treatment in healthcare facilities. The design process involves meticulous specification of gas supply requirements, allocation network layout, and stringent adherence to industry standards like NFPA 99. Expert engineers utilize specialized software tools for simulation and optimization, factoring in parameters such as flow rates, pressure drops, and potential failures. Upon completion of the design, installation procedures are meticulously followed to guarantee a seamless integration of pipelines, valves, regulators, and monitoring equipment. Regular maintenance play a critical role in preserving system integrity and conformance with safety regulations.

Ensuring Safety with Medical Gas Pipeline Leak Control

Medical gas pipelines deliver essential oxygen, nitrous oxide, and other gases to healthcare facilities. Maintaining the integrity of these systems is paramount to patient safety. Regular inspections and effective leak detection methods are crucial for identifying potential concerns before they escalate get more info into dangerous situations. Implementing various methods, such as sniffer detectors, pressure gauges, and ultrasonic testing, allows for the precise identification of even minor leaks. Once detected, immediate repair is essential to ensure the safety and reliability of the medical gas pipeline system.

  • Preventive maintenance measures, including scheduled inspections, can greatly minimize the risk of leaks.
  • Allocating in high-quality materials and sturdy pipeline components is vital for long-term system integrity.
  • Proper installation practices, adhering to industry regulations, are indispensable to prevent leaks from occurring in the first place.
